House for sale near Sredets

The village where this house is situated is tucked at the foot of the Strandzha mountain. At the same time the Black sea coast is only at 49 km. far or just some 45 minutes drive.

The place is buried in verdure. A frisky little river passes along the village. It’ s difficult to believe how calm and quiet a place can be if you don’t see that spot. The area is good for hunting and fishing.


This house has one floor which provides 80 sq.m living area. An asphalted road leads to the gate of the property just in front of the house the yard is cemented and a lovely trellis vine overshadows it. The house is supplied with electricity and running water. The toilet is outside the house.

The property includes a garden which is about 1000 sq.m. The property needs some major repairs in order t become nice and suitable place for your vacation. You would love the place if you see it!
